    3. I have a Sarah Law b. 4 Jul 1860/61 in Washington County, PA. Parents are Thomas R. Law b. 1820-1830 in PA and Margaret Jane Walker b. 25 Dec 1853 possibly in WV or Germany. This isn't much and I don't have any other information, but the name may run in the family. Let me know if this leads to anything for you. Roberta [email protected]

    3. Hello, Well, I have little information but found from my ggrandfather's (Seth Hendricks) death certificate that his father was James Hendricks and mother was Sarah Law. Seth, according to the certificate, was born in Sharon, Mercer Co., PA. in 1847. I have been unable to find any record of them in the Census of Mercer for 1850 or 1860. In 1870 Seth was living with his wife in Allegheny Co., PA and lived there until his death in 1927. It is possible that Sarah Law lived in OH before her marriage. Any help will be greatly appreciated. If you have an unidentified Sarah Law in PA., maybe this is mine. Jim Hendricks email: [email protected] >

    3. Dear Derek, I checked the Raney notes on John Laws, Sr. descendants that remained in Va for at least one generation. There was no Benjamin Or Elbert in the Families of John, Jr., Burwell, Danile Henry or David. The famileisof Jesse and William are not coverend very well at all since they left the area in late 1790's or early 1800's. there are however descendants of both of these sons on this list. I could not find any mention of MS either. I just thought that I would let you know that someone had checked. Susan in CT
